Satoru Nakajima F-1 Hero 2 is a licensed Formula One racing simulation published by Varie exclusively for the Famicom. Players compete across authentic Grand Prix circuits, managing acceleration, braking and corner lines. Pit stop timing and tyre wear influence race pace throughout multi-lap contests.
Each circuit features unique curve layouts and hazard zones. Careless off-track driving damages the car and reduces maximum speed.
Modes include single grand prix rounds, sequential full championship progression against AI rivals and alternating two-player versus races.
Varie’s clean top-down F1 circuit visuals and upbeat racing soundtrack maintain energetic world-championship atmosphere.
Strategically, consistent podium results requires planning pit stops early. Delayed servicing leads to crippling tyre degradation late in the race.
